I've been training with the same nutrition for months....and months. Not once was I toppled over in my running shoes with my stomach in knots. Rarely did my stomach even grumble. And so I jump jump into this final month of the most physically stressful training of my lifetime. And now, something ain't working right. Tuesday I had another run where my second Vanilla GU, about an hour into my run, caused me to stop (for a few minutes) rather than helping me to push onward. This has happened before and within the last month. I have 3 weeks to figure this out. Man, seems so strange that I handled the GU so well and now........ugh!! If I do go with a different gel, I don't so much like the idea of trying it out over my taper. I need to know how it works when I'm pushing limits. I feel great about my training to this point. The swimming has come around. The bike has been there from the beginning. The first half of the run I'll be fine, and the second half of the run I'll finish on willpower alone if I have to. But stomachache's......man, not something I want to pop up at this point. But I suppose since it did, I oughta do something.
